2. Fable II

Platform: Xbox 360
US Release Year: 2008
Overall Rating: 3.9 out of 5 stars
Genres: Action (Sandbox), Strategy (Simulation), Role Playing (RPG) (Elements)
ESRB Rating: M
Developer: Lionhead Studios
Publisher: Microsoft Game Studios
Synopsis: Set once again in the land of Albion, 500 years after the original Fable in a time of colonization, castles and firearms. Growing up in the slums of Bowerstone, Sparrow, along with his sister Rose, want more than anything to live in Castle Fairfax. A magic box seemingly grants their wish, but Lord Lucien has his own plans shooting Rose and Sparrow. Ten year later, Sparrow must find the three heroes and prevent Lord Lucian from rebuilding the Tattered Spire and gaining untold power. Once again, choose a righteous or evil path to reach your goal.

3. ActRaiser

Platform: Super Nintendo (SNES)
US Release Year: 1991
Overall Rating: 4.3 out of 5 stars
Genres: Action (2D Platformer), Strategy (Simulation)
Developer: Quintet
Publisher: Enix
Synopsis: A combination platformer and world-building game you play as "The Master" who has been asleep for centuries after losing a battle with "The Evil One" Tanzra who has turned the people of the land to evil. In order to restore his power, The Master will have to defeat Tanzra's six lieutenants, win back the people of the land and finally face Tanzra at his stronghold Death Heim.

9. Stardew Valley

Platform: PC (Steam)
US Release Year: 2016
Overall Rating: 4.0 out of 5 stars
Genres: Role Playing (RPG), Strategy (Simulation)
ESRB Rating: E10+
Developer: ConcernedApe
Publisher: ChuckleFish
Synopsis: You have inherited your grandfather's old farm plot in Stardew Valley. With only some
old tools and pocketful of coins, can you turn this overgrown plot of land in to a home?
Stardew Valley itself has seen better days as the Joja Corporation has moved in and
all but eliminated the old ways, with the Community Center lying in shambles. If you can
restore your home, why not all of Stardew Valley? And maybe you can even find love...
Explore a vast world and improve five areas: farming, mining, combat, fishing, and
foraging. Engage with over 30 unique characters, each with their own stories, explore
a vast, mysterious cave and get lost in the open world as you explore all the
possibilities around you.
